(1) Global and China's off-highway tire production and sales are booming

Because off-highway tires are a segment of the tire market, and there are many varieties involved, and the company discloses less information, the industry lacks special statistical data on the supply of off-highway tires as a whole market. However, from the prospectus of Haian Rubber, we can see that the production of engineering tires and all-steel giant tires in off-highway tires has a rapid development. With the acceleration of the world's industrialization process, the global production of engineered tires continues to rise. Global off-highway tire engineering tire production basically maintained an upward trend, from 100 million in 2016 to 340 million in 2021, with a compound annual growth rate of 27.73%, according to Frost Sullivan, 2026, global engineering tire production will further increase to 500 million.

In the vigorous development of the global steel giant tire, China is expected to maintain a high growth rate and increase the global market share. Compared with giant bias tires, giant all-steel radial tires have lower heat generation due to structural differences, effectively reducing tread and shoulder delamination, and their service life is more than 2 times that of giant bias tires, greatly improving the service life of tires. Due to the advantages of the structural design of the giant all-steel radial tire, the product refurbishment rate is higher than that of the giant bias tire, and the giant all-steel radial tire is lighter in weight, lower in rolling resistance, more fuel saving and environmental protection, and can obtain better economic benefits, and the all-steel giant tire gradually replaces the bias giant tire, and the output rises rapidly. According to Frost and Sullivan, in terms of output, the global market size of all steel giant tires increased from 163,000 in 2016 to 192,000 in 2021, with a compound annual growth rate of 3.33%, and the market continues to be in short supply. The size of China's all-steel giant tire market increased from 12,000 in 2016 to 26,000 in 2022, with a compound annual growth rate of 13.92%.

(2) Overseas giants occupy a dominant position, and domestic enterprises are growing rapidly

Due to the complex application road conditions and difficult production, the supply of global off-highway tires mainly comes from overseas tire companies. Among them, Bridgestone, Michelin, Goodyear and other enterprises led. In the whole steel giant tire segment, Michelin, Bridgestone, Goodyear three giant enterprises global market share maintained at more than 85%. We sorted out the production capacity of off-highway tires of overseas tire companies. Due to the limitations of the data, we make the following explanations for this data: (1) The data comes from the Tire Business in the United States, which sorted out the number of factories of some tire companies in the world, the product types of each factory, the production capacity of each factory, etc., from which we sorted out the production capacity information related to off-highway tires. (2) We divide the factories related to off-highway tires into two types: the first type only produces off-highway tires (type 1), the second type produces off-highway tires and other tires (type 2), and the sum of the capacity of the first two types of factories is type 3. "Tire Business" does not separately disclose the production capacity of off-road tires in Type 2 factories, so the range of enterprise off-road tire production capacity should be between Type 1 and Type 3. (3) Because the weight difference of a single tire of off-highway tires may be large, the capacity units disclosed by each enterprise are not consistent (tons or strips), so we have two types of unit calibers in statistics, and the two are listed in parallel.

Due to data limitations, "Tire Business" did not disclose the off-highway tire production capacity of Type 2 factories, so we cannot analyze or compare the entire off-highway tire production capacity of enterprises, but we can analyze and compare the production capacity of type 1. We would like to emphasize that the Type 1 capacity is not the total capacity of the company's off-highway tires, but the total capacity of the plant that only produces off-highway tires. From the results of our statistics, the three global tire giants Michelin, Bridgestone and Goodyear all have pure off-highway tire factories (Type 1), Michelin's pure off-highway tire factory capacity of 138,200 tons/year, Bridgestone's 159,300 tons/year + 1.5 million/year, Goodyear's 30,000 / year. Yokohama Japan also has more pure off-highway plant capacity, but it contains a higher percentage of agricultural off-highway tires than Michelin and Bridgestone.

Michelin: Founded in 1889, Michelin has developed innovative technologies in off-road tires. Michelin is a leading company in the all-steel giant tire, and in 2001 Michelin launched the first 63 inch construction machinery tire. In 2018, Michelin completed the acquisition of the Canadian Camso Group, which by 2018 had taken a leading position in "the market for rubber tracks for agricultural equipment and snowmobiles" and "the market for solid and bias tires for material handling equipment assembly". In the "small infrastructure equipment assembly of track and needed tire solutions" market, the top three, net sales reached $1 billion. The acquisition of Camo Speed further helps Michelin lead the non-road tire market. Michelin has 51 factories in 18 countries or regions on 5 continents, of which the production of off-highway tires is mainly located in the United States and France. Bridgestone: Bridgestone is headquartered in Japan. Bridgestone operates 48 plants in 18 countries on five continents, seven of which specialize in off-highway tires, including three in Japan, two in the United States, one in Spain and one in Thailand.
